Transaction 90fa0dda77fdb55412a44a4f5f2c6f82643e3d2755992660a094a23115ca4003

2 Input
2 Outputs
  • 90fa0dda77fdb55412a44a4f5f2c6f82643e3d2755992660a094a23115ca4003:0
  • value  10918228
    address  18f8hRYtzEWkTGyVSxys7YPi3deuLcRKf7
  • 90fa0dda77fdb55412a44a4f5f2c6f82643e3d2755992660a094a23115ca4003:1
  • value  121810
    address  12WLff8z1Kor9qzpFYTDLWDbuFMGKnwyPg